Mother Reacts to Daughter's Meningitis Diagnosis

The mother of a young woman hospitalized with meningitis expressed to the BBC that she was "absolutely shocked" upon learning of her daughter's condition.

Khali Goodwin's daughter, Keeleigh, aged 21 and employed in a restaurant, collapsed at her flat in Canterbury on Saturday night. Her flatmate promptly took her to the hospital.

At the hospital, Keeleigh was diagnosed with meningitis. She received antibiotic treatment and has begun to show signs of improvement.

Khali Goodwin mentioned that although she was aware Keeleigh was unwell, meningitis "hadn't even been on my radar." She also praised Keeleigh's flatmate for "saving her life."
